2015-11-27から1日間の記事一覧

ON_NOTIFYで登録されてるアイテムにメッセージを飛ばす

MFC

ON_NOTIFY(LVN_ITEMCHANGED, ..., ...)で登録されている場合 NMHDR nmhdr; nmhdr.code = LVN_ITEMCHANGED; nmhdr.idFrom = controlId; nmhdr.hwndFrom = controlWindowHandle; SendMessage( targetWindowHandle, WM_NOTIFY, controlId, &nmhdr );ネタ元 http…

CListCtrlでアイテムをフォーカス&選択状態にする

MFC

SetItemState(nItem, // フォーカス&選択状態にしたいアイテムのインデックス LVIS_FOCUSED | LVIS_SELECTED, // 状態 LVIS_FOCUSED | LVIS_SELECTED); // マスクネタ元 http://rarara.cafe.coocan.jp/cgi-bin/lng/vc/vclng.cgi?print+200209/02090112.txt

mfcで画面を強制的に再描画させる方法

mfc

問答無用なら InvalidateRect(0,0,false); //画面全体に再描画を要求ウインドウハンドルしていすれば、そのアイテムだけ再描画するネタ元 http://okwave.jp/qa/q112210.html

MacのF1、F2などのキーの設定を「ファンクションキー」にする

Mac

「システム環境設定」の「キーボード」パネル(または、「キーボードとマウス」パネル)で設定します。 ネタ元 http://inforati.jp/apple/mac-tips-techniques/system-hints/how-to-use-function-key-as-default-in-mac-os.html